Painting Found In Elderly French Woman's Home Sells For $26.6 Million

NEW YORK (CBSNewYork) - A small painting found in a French woman's kitchen has turned into the most expensive medieval artwork ever sold.

The painting "Christ Mocked" by 13th-century artist Cimabue has sold at auction for more than $26 million.

It was discovered after a woman in her 90s decided to sell her house and asked an appraiser to see if she had anything of value inside.

She had no idea the tiny artwork that was displayed above her stove for decades was actually a masterpiece.
